On 1 April, Jetstar pranked its readers that it was adopting Singlish as its official language. But now, they are doing it for real. But for one day only, 9 Aug – the day Singapore kena kicked out of Malaysia.

In a video published in its Facebook titled, “Wah seh, Jetstar really goes Singlish, no bluff!”, Jetstar said that their Singlish onboard announcements will only be on some flights, especially on the once flying into Singapore.
